phylogenetic analysis of the downy mildew pathogen of oilseed poppy in tasmania, and its detection by pcr.downy mildew of oilseed poppy (papaver somniferum) has become a serious disease issue for the tasmanian poppy industry since its first record in 1996. previous reports have reported the pathogen as peronospora arborescens, which is differentiated from the related species p. cristata, also known to infect papaver spp., by conidium dimensions alone. this study investigated the taxonomic status of the downy mildew pathogen, using both morphological characters and molecular analysis of the internal ...200415119357
